FAQ PRIVATE TOURS
What to know about your boat trip
Can I bring my dog or pet on board?
We accept small dogs (maximum 10 kg) on many of our boats. It is compulsory to indicate their presence when booking. Extra charge 15€.
Are there life jackets on board?
Yes, every boat is equipped with all safety equipment required by law, including life jackets for adults and children (always check the availability of specific sizes for children when booking) and all fire-fighting and first aid equipment.
How long do private tours with a driver last?
Private chauffeur-driven tours can be customised to suit guests' needs. The duration varies from a minimum of 1 hour to a maximum of 8 hours, with a choice of half or full day, ideal for exploring the coast at leisure and enjoying each stop.
Where is the meeting point? Are there parking spaces available?
The meeting point for boat hire and shared tours is at our Yacht Club “Nausika”, Via Montecchio Nord 21 - 23823 Colico (LC). Reservable parking spaces are available here at a cost of €15.
For private tours, the meeting point can be arranged as required.
Are the boats insured?
Yes. All our vessels are covered by compulsory insurance, as required by current regulations. Insurance cover details are available and can be consulted, ensuring maximum transparency.
What happens in case of bad weather?
Safety is our top priority. In the event of adverse weather conditions that make sailing unsafe, the captain (if any) or our team will assess the options.
Generally, an attempt will be made to reschedule the charter or tour date. If this is not possible, the refund policies in the contract terms will apply.
